¿How long does porcelain veneers
last?
Porcelain veneers were initially design
in the 1980. Many thins can affect the
duration of the veneers: The quality of
the adhesion to the tooth structure, the
patient bite, as well of inadequate use
of teeth, like opening a bottle, cutting
things with the teeth, etc. In good
situations they can last for a long
time.
We have patients that have their veneers
for over 11 years with no problems at
all. Today with the advances in tooth
adhesion we can achieve excellent
performance. It is very reasonable to
think in an average of 10 years of
performance for the veneers if there
aren’t high risk conditions in the bite
of the patient, always accompany by good
compliance with a preventive plan to
keep good gum health.
Since the veneers are place on top of
my teeth, they look tick and fake ¿Can
this be prevented?
Porcelain veneers shouldn’t look thick
if they are done correctly. It happens
when teeth are not prepared correctly or
the lab makes them too tick. To prevent
this mistake a detailed evaluation of
the smile must be done to design a good
treatment plan and a high-Tec lab with
experience on veneers must be selected
to achieve excellent esthetics.

¿Do veneers fall easily?
When the teeth are prepared correctly
and they are cemented to the teeth with
the adequate technique, if there are no
problems with the bite they shouldn’t
fall.
This is usually cause by inadequate
bonding to the teeth. This is a very
sensitive procedure, if the tooth and
porcelain surfaces are contaminated by
saliva or oil, the bonding will fail.

There are stains around the veneers and
I can see the dark color of my teeth,
¿How can this be fix?
The most common reason for this problem
is incorrect cementation of the veneers.
The cement can discolor or there is a
space where food and bacteria are
collected causing stains and maybe even
decay. When the original color of the
tooth is visible this is due to an
improper design of the tooth preparation
for the veneer to cover these areas.
To solve this problem new veneers have
to be done with adequate preparation and
bonding techniques, A high-Tec lab that
make veneers that adapt correctly to the
teeth must be use to create excellent
results.
